The second annual ice passage on Lake Balkhash “Uly Balkash Shagyrady”

In February, Almaty Management University organized the second annual ice passage on Lake Balkhash “Uly Balkash Shagyrady!” to tackle ecological problems in Kazakhstan.

The purpose of the transition: to draw the attention of Kazakhstani society to the environmental problems of the Great Balkhash and support domestic tourism in Kazakhstan. Since the time of the Silk Road, Lake Balkhash and Balkhash has been playing an important role as a historical, cultural, ethnographic and economic region.


Save Balqash to save the future

Participants of the second ice passage Uly Balqash shakyrady - 2020 emphasized the aim of the ice walk/passage as to paying attention to the ecology of Lake Balkhash. More than 100 Kazakhstanis decided on an unusual method of drawing public attention to the pollution of Lake Balkhash as a passage along Lake Balkhash, and 90 of them made the transition at different distances, 12 km. and 24 km. Compared to last year, the number of participants doubled twice. This is a clear indicator that more and more people are paying attention to the topic of ecology. In particular, to the problem of the ecology of Lake Balkhash. The organizer for the second year in a row is Almaty Management University (Graduate School of Business). AlmaU, as a socially responsible university, initiates and implements, together with partners and caring residents of our country, many social and environmental projects, among them the Uly Balqash shakyrady - 2020 ice passage stands out in that it managed to attract the attention of friends and partners, sponsors of RG Brands , YAM-EEE! and Ülker, Nomad Explorer, Turan Express, ULKER, World Class, Azamattyk Alliance AUL, Almaty Marathons and the Kazakh Geographical Society, Turan TV channel, MIR 24 interstate broadcasting company, Tengrinews online publication and HOLAnews.
